GPU,CUDA,cuDNN的理解和安装

GPU,CUDA,cuDNN的理解:https://blog.csdn.net/u014380165/article/details/77340765

安装对应版本的cuda/cudnn:
https://docs.nvidia.com/deeplearning/sdk/cudnn-install/index.html#install-windows

验证CUDA安装成功:
打开命令行,也就是cmd然后输入“nvcc -V”,如果安装正确的话你应该看到这样的输出:

C:\Users\Administrator>nvcc -V
nvcc: NVIDIA (R) Cuda compiler driver
Copyright (c) 2005-2016 NVIDIA Corporation
Built on Mon_Jan__9_17:32:33_CST_2017
Cuda compilation tools, release 8.0, V8.0.60

NVIDIA 不同GPU的计算能力 Compute Capability 一览:
https://blog.csdn.net/ksws0292756/article/details/79180816

windows使用nvidia-smi查看gpu信息:
https://blog.csdn.net/nima1994/article/details/79698102

gpu的compute capability查询方法:
nvidia-smi 查看最上面显示的是什么型号的gpu.
GPU,CUDA,cuDNN的理解和安装_第1张图片

可以看到,我的四块gpu都是GeForce GTX 108…,然后在【英伟达给出的官网】上查询得知计算能力是6.1

查看gpu是否支持cudnn,
https://developer.nvidia.com/cuda-gpus
项目默认是开启cudnn的,而CUDNN要求GPU CUDA Capability 不小于3.0
对于不满足条件的GPU,需要在项目中关闭CUDNN。preprocessor definitions 里面删除USE_CUDNN。

你可能感兴趣的:(GPU,CUDA,cuDNN的理解和安装)